Irama Melayu continued to develop rapidly in Indonesia’s post-Independence era with the rise of Soekarno’s anti-imperialist rhetoric. The heyday of Irama Melayu, popular throughout Indonesia and Malaysia, was during the 1940s. Classic dangdut developed from Malay music (also known as Irama Melayu) which was influenced by Arabic, Indian, Chinese, and Portuguese musics. Koplo, dangdut koplo, and modern dangdut have all evolved from classic dangdut. Is koplo really a genre? Perhaps it's better seen as a kind of beat, or an idea? Or maybe it oscillates between these meanings? In this article, I use the terms koplo or dangdut koplo interchangeably to denote a genre, a beat, or an idea. Its scenes, innovations, and variations emerge and disappear in short time frames, which makes me wonder how exactly to approach it. Such boasting, known as "sawer," "nyawer," or "saweran," happens in all sorts of contexts and is often carried out by the very people who can least afford it. Even though the band is paid, it is common to see audience members "show off their wealth" by giving money directly to the singer during performances. The audience, police, and drink vendors all join in dancing to the music. »Keloas« by Rena Movies, aka Rena KDI and OM Monata. Is it because koplo emerged from the grassroots of Indonesian societies? What does grassroot mean in the Indonesian context? After all, a large portion of Indonesia’s population can be regarded as being grassroots or from lower social classes who are not empowered in terms of holding financial power, education, or other rights as citizens. This also applies to classic dangdut, wayang kulit, and gamelan orchestras.ĭespite this status, koplo is still somewhat marginal. As such, koplo is one of the forms of folk art which has a special position in society. Playing loud koplo music is accepted, but on the other hand, permission is required if you want to perform pop, experimental, or other kinds of modern music. Koplo is also played by buskers and itinerant traders, in cafes and restaurants, on public transport, and even in city council offices. How is koplo present in everyday life in Indonesia? Well, for one, no one protests when koplo is blasted through large speakers in a crowded residential area. One of the most popular dangdut koplo songs from the last 10 years is Nella Kharisma’s, »Jaran Goyang.«

Long before iTunes, Spotify, or download services proliferated, koplo spread through pirated CDs and VCDs, and other downloadable or transferrable media. Koplo artists are creating their own new industry. Koplo has come to prominence since big labels and conventional music industry channels have declined. As such, koplo is a marginalised musical form. It may also be due to the fact that many people in Indonesia regard koplo as a worthless form of music, a kind of mucking about that doesn’t represent Indonesian culture. Indeed, one might need a specific keyword to enter the algorithm of the world of koplo on the internet.
